question about multiple block write command for SD card

1 post / 0 new
  • 1
  • 2
  • 3
  • 4
  • 5
Total votes: 0


I'm searching for the info about the multiple block write command for SD card, and also the ACMD23 (SET_WR_BLK_ERASE_COUNT) command which sets the number of blocks to be preeased before using multiple block write.

I found conflicting info from different sources about whether STOP_TRAN(CMD12) command should be used to stop the transmission in Write Mulitple Block whether the preerase (ACMD23) feature
is used or not.

I did test on all of my microSD cards, and found out that STOP_TRAN command can be skipped and the data written is still fine.

Anyone have idea about this?